MLS # CAR4011853 WebGranite cools very slowly miles below the surface of the earth; this slow cooling over millions of years allows for the formation of sizable mineral crystals within the slowly cooling mass of molten rock. Rhyolite typically cools more rapidly near the earth's surface and contains smaller mineral crystals than granite.

WebGranite is an intrusive igneous rock, which means it crystallized from molten rock, called magma, miles underground.
